"Journey of the Ox: A Tale of Zen Wisdom and Global Significance" In the realm of Zen Buddhism, a captivating series of paintings known as the ten Ox Herding Pictures narrates a profound spiritual journey. The first painting depicts the arduous task of catching the Ox, symbolizing our quest to tame our wandering minds. As we progress, we encounter another artwork illustrating herding the Ox, representing our growing ability to control our thoughts and emotions. The third painting portrays an awe-inspiring scene where one returns home on the back of an Ox. This image encapsulates finding inner peace and contentment through self-discovery.
